Changing Route Options The options for how a route is computed can be changed to Fastest Time, Shortest Distance, Mostly Freeways, Least Use of Freeways. 1. Access the Maneuver List. 2. Tap on Route Options. 3. The four types of routes are displayed with the computed time. 4. Tap on the desired route option. 5. The GO screen is displayed. Tap GO to begin routing.
